Jalan C.M. Yusuf (British: Chamberlain Road; Chinese transliteration: 張伯倫路; Pinyin: Zhāngbólún Lù; Cantonese Jyutping romanisation: Zoeng1baa3leon4 Lou6) is one of the main roads in Ipoh. It leads out of Ipoh New Town from the south. Jalan C.M. Yusuf connects with Jalan Datuk Onn Jaafar and Jalan Raja Musa Aziz in the north and Jalan Kampar in the south. In between, it meets Jalan Bendahara at a roundabout. Other roads branching off from Jalan C.M. Yusuf include Jalan Dato Tahwil Azar, Jalan Yang Kalsom and Jalan Pasir Puteh.

Jalan C.M. Yusuf was named after Tan Sri Chik Mohamad Yusuf (1907-1975), better known as C.M. Yusuf. A nobleman holding the Perak royal title of Orang Besar, he was the third Speaker of the Dewan Rakyat at Parliament. Before that, the road was originally named Chamberlain Road, after the Secretary of the Colonies of the Coalition Government, Joseph Chamberlain (1836-1914)
